Mohammad Nazemasharieh
Seyed Mohammad Nazemasharieh (Persian: سید محمد ناظمالشریعه; born 22 September 1969) is an Iranian retired futsal player and current coach. He is head coach of Iran national futsal team.

He nominated for world best futsal coach title in 2016.[2]
Honours
National team
- Third-place, FIFA Futsal World Cup, 2016
- Champions, AFC Futsal Championship, 2016 ; 2018
- Runners-up, Grand Prix de Futsal, 2015
- Champions, Futsal at the 2017 Asian Indoor and Martial Arts Games
